Classification of children with learning problems and the establishment of special classes in Delaware from the 1930s to the mid-1940s.

This study focuses on J. E. Wallace Wallin, who recognised the rights of children with disabilities to receive an education, and who tackled the scientific classification of children and the provision of special classes in the state of Delaware from the 1930s to the middle of the 1940s.
